§ 22.051 — DEFINITION; OTHER IMMUNITY
ED § 22.051Title 2. PUBLIC EDUCATION · Part D. EDUCATORS AND SCHOOL DISTRICT EMPLOYEES AND VOLUNTEERS · Ch. 22. SCHOOL DISTRICT EMPLOYEES AND VOLUNTEERS · Art. B. CIVIL IMMUNITY
Statute text
View on source(a)In this subchapter, "professional employee of a school district" includes:
(1)a superintendent, principal, teacher, including a substitute teacher, supervisor, social worker, school counselor, nurse, and teacher's aide employed by a school district;
(2)a teacher employed by a company that contracts with a school district to provide the teacher's services to the district;
(3)a student in an education preparation program participating in a field experience or internship;
(4)a school bus driver certified in accordance with standards and qualifications adopted by the Department of Public Safety of the State of Texas;
(5)a member of the board of trustees of an independent school district; and
